INSTRUCTOR/LECTURER
UNIVERSITY OF SOUTH DAKOTA
Beginning: August 22, 2023
The Department of Communication Studies at the University of South Dakota seeks applications for a full-time instructor/lecturer in interpersonal and organizational communication. This nine-month, full-time, benefits-eligible position is open to candidates who have demonstrated excellence in teaching, pedagogical design, and course management. This position will have primary responsibility for CMST210 Interpersonal Communication for Business, a prerequisite for admission to USD’s Beacom School of Business. The successful applicant will also have an opportunity to teach other courses in business communication, including Organizational Communication, Interviewing, Small Group Communication, and Business & Professional Communication.
The Department of Communication Studies at USD has a reputation for high quality teaching and support of undergraduate research. Administratively home in the College of Arts & Sciences, we offer undergraduate degrees and a master’s degree in Communication, offered in collaboration with the Department of Media & Journalism. The Department of Communication Studies is committed to promoting the power of ethical and effective communication and creating a supportive environment for the free exchange of ideas.
The University of South Dakota is the state’s flagship institution, the oldest university, and the only public liberal arts university in South Dakota. USD offers undergraduate, graduate, and professional programs to more than 10,000 students, and is located in Vermillion, a small and dynamic community nestled along the bluffs above the Missouri River in the southeast corner of South Dakota. Located one hour from South Dakota’s largest city, the area offers many recreational and cultural opportunities.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Successful candidates will teach on-campus and online undergraduate and graduate courses in area(s) of expertise (4-4 teaching load). They will also direct and guide other instructors teaching CMST210 Interpersonal Communication in Business, will mentor and advise graduate and undergraduate students, and provide discipline-related service to the department, college, university, discipline, and the wider public.
QUALIFICATIONS:
Minimum Qualifications for Instructor rank: A master’s degree in Communication Studies or a closely related area is required, along with demonstrated excellence in teaching undergraduate communication courses.
Minimum Qualifications for Lecturer rank: A terminal degree in Communication Studies or a closely related area; a candidate that is ABD will be considered. Demonstrated excellence in teaching and mentoring undergraduate and graduate students.
